J’UNCLE is an original story about a guy who is the king of his castle and lives life on his own terms. Never mind that his castle is his younger brother’s tool garage and his terms are, at best, questionable. The script examines family relations, as well as societal expectations and norms… and how they seem to be changing drastically these days – in nearly every way.
This script – written as a 3-episode season – is about an hour and a half long AND is the first of… hopefully many seasons to come (the next is already in the works). This is a dialogue and character driven piece, a lot of meticulous detail.

Character Type/Restrictions:
JAMES LEWIS, 37 years old, lives in his brother’s garage. He’s a little scrawny, smart, quick witted, aware of current events, and always has an opinion. He lives in shorts, a T, and flip-flops. There is VERY brief nudity, less than 5 seconds; there will be opportunity to use set pieces to block some viewers.
STEPHEN, Jim’s 4 years younger brother. Stephen could not be more different than Jim: tall, good looking, successful, happily married to Verity and expecting his first child. He sometimes speaks before he thinks, causing awkward embarrassment.
VERITY is over 3 years younger than Jim and slightly older than her husband Stephen. She gets along very well with both brothers – this is crucial to the story. She can get along with a lot of people; but is not a pushover. She is fun, understanding, compassionate, and doesn’t take herself or life too seriously.
